The Ascent of International Umbrella Firms in Global Payroll

With the growing pace of globalization, businesses are increasingly seeking innovative solutions to manage their international payroll operations. One such solution gaining significant traction is the rise of international umbrella companies. These specialized firms provide a efficient platform for hiring talent across borders, simplifying complex regulatory requirements and ensuring adherence with diverse local labor laws.

  • Utilizing a global network of legal entities, umbrella companies act as the employer of record for international staff, assuming responsibility for payroll processing, tax withholdings, benefits administration, and further employee-related duties. This allows businesses to focus their resources on core operational activities while ensuring a smooth and compliant international payroll framework.
  • Moreover, umbrella companies offer a range of {addedbenefits, such as cultural sensitivity training, which can be invaluable for businesses navigating the intricacies of international hiring.

Given the rapidly complex global business landscape, international umbrella companies are proving a vital tool for businesses seeking to develop their international footprint.

Umbrella Companies for Freelancers Abroad

Navigating the nuances of freelancing abroad can be a tricky task. Between tax laws, ensuring compliance and smooth operations can be stressful. This is where global employment solutions step in to provide valuable resources for freelancers operating across borders. An umbrella company acts as a legal entity, employing individual freelancers and managing their financial aspects.

  • By leveraging an umbrella company, freelancers can enjoy simplified tax processes.
  • Furthermore, they can gain access to a wider range of gigs and receive professional growth in their field.

Before choosing an umbrella company, it's essential to carefully research and compare different options based on factors like rates, benefits offered, and standing within the industry.
